Black, Nate E.; Vehrs, Pat R.; Fellingham, Gilbert W.; George, James D.; Hager, Ron – Research Quarterly for Exercise and Sport, 2016
Purpose: The purpose of this study was to evaluate the use of a treadmill walk-jog-run exercise test previously validated in adults and physical activity questionnaire data to estimate maximum oxygen consumption (VO[subscript 2]max) in boys (n = 62) and girls (n = 66) aged 12 to 17 years old. Hilgenkamp, Thessa Irena Maria; Baynard, Tracy – Journal of Applied Research in Intellectual Disabilities, 2018
Background: Individuals with intellectual disability (ID) have very low physical activity and low peak oxygen uptake (VO[subscript 2peak]), potentially explained by physiologically lower peak heart rates (HR[subscript peak]). Bennie, Jason A.; Wiesner, Glen H.; Vergeer, Ineke; Kolbe-Alexander, Tracy L.; De Cocker, Katrien; Alexander, Chris; Biddle, Stuart J. H. – Research Quarterly for Exercise and Sport, 2018
Purpose: There is currently no standardized testing protocol for assessing clients' fitness/health within the Australian fitness industry. This study examined the perceptions of the feasibility of using a standardized testing protocol among Australian fitness industry professionals. Scott, Alexander; Antonishen, Kevin; Johnston, Chris; Pearce, Terri; Ryan, Michael; Sheel, A. William; McKenzie, Don C. – Measurement in Physical Education and Exercise Science, 2006
The study was designed to determine the effect of upright-posture (UP) versus semirecumbent (SR) cycling on commonly used measures of maximal and submaximal exercise capacity. Bradshaw, Danielle I.; George, James D.; Hyde, Annette; LaMonte, Michael J.; Vehrs, Pat R.; Hager, Ronald L.; Yanowitz, Frank G. – Research Quarterly for Exercise and Sport, 2005
The purpose of this study was to develop a regression equation to predict maximal oxygen uptake (VO[subscript 2]max) based on nonexercise (N-EX) data.
